Well his Camaro has a RWD setup, the TGp has a FWD setup. On the TGP, the turbo mounts on top of the trannsmission, kind of behind the motor. In a Camaro, it can't mount there(firewall), so they typically mount them on the passenger side of the engine. Totally different setup, with different exhaust manifolds, downpipes, charge piping, intercooler setup, etc.
